It is the third and final installment in Fred Vogel's notorious "pseudo-snuff" trilogy, following August Underground (2001) and August Underground's Mordum (2003). Context & Film Overview
Plot: Unlike its predecessors, which focused primarily on random acts of violence, Penance follows the two killers from the previous films as they become increasingly sloppy and paranoid. The narrative concludes with their eventual downfall as their crimes catch up to them.
August Underground is a notorious series of extreme horror films (specifically August Underground, August Underground’s Mordum, and August Underground’s Penance) known for their hyper-realistic, found-footage style depicting graphic violence, torture, and serial murder. The films are widely considered among the most controversial and disturbing movies ever made, often banned or heavily restricted. Penance (2007) is the third installment, directed by Fred Vogel.
